As I understand it, evening primrose and borage both have gla, it's just that
borage oil is more economical because it contains a higher percentage of gla
so you can take less capsules than you would have to take of evening primrose
in order to get the same amount of gla.  Can I ask how many mg of GLA you
take per day in the form of evening primrose?
